How they compare

Finland currently reports 0.0093 kt against 0.0078 kt in Australia and New Zealand, a difference of 0.0015 kt.

That makes Finland's figure about 1.2 times Australia and New Zealand's.

The two have swapped places 16 times across 65 shared years of data; in 1961 it was Finland ahead.

Australia and New Zealand ranks 28th and Finland ranks 26th of 66 countries.

Finland has averaged higher in every one of the 9 decades both report.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
